**Action item (SPRT-watering outage, owner: on-call rotation):** So the Sproutly scheduler basically drowned the greenhouse beds because the moisture-sensor debounce was way too short and every blip triggered a full cycle. We agreed to widen the debounce window, cap consecutive watering runs, and add a cooldown between zones. Please sanity-check these against the Fernvale pilot site before the next deploy — that site has the flakiest sensors and will surface problems fast. The agreed tuning constants are as follows.

tuning table, fawip-fahag:
WEIGHTS = {
    "novwyn": 452,
    "casdor": 675,
}

## Provenance: idempotency keys in retry handling

For future maintainers of the Lattermill payments service: the idempotency-key scheme used for payment retries changed in the v9 line. Keys are now derived from the order fingerprint plus attempt window, not a client nonce, which closed the double-charge gap found during the Westrow audit. Each build that alters key derivation is recorded in the provenance ledger. The build that introduced this behavior is identified below.

pipeline stamp: htk9_6ce9d33c5

Given rising exposure from the Teslind charter contracts, the committee approved forward contracts covering 70% of projected foreign-currency receipts for the next four quarters. Options were considered but rejected on cost grounds. Treasurer Ingrid Malsow will report hedge effectiveness quarterly. Counterparty limits remain unchanged, and the policy will be revisited if exposure shifts by more than 15%. The confidential note on related expansion plans is appended below.

internal memo for kaguf-yajog: Headcount on the Druath team goes from 30 to 70 by the end of November. Gross margin on Druath came in at 56 percent against a plan of 28 percent.

This page covers the Brightline Partner Programme for our Kestrel Suite products. Tiering is based on certified staff and trailing four-quarter revenue, reviewed by the channel committee each January. Sales leads should not quote tier-two discounts to prospective resellers until onboarding paperwork is complete, as pricing remains under review. Disputes over territory boundaries in the Avenor region go to Priya in channel ops first. Before advising any partner on next year's terms, consult the note appended below.

management briefing: Project Ulavan slips by two quarters because of the staffing delay.